ISD 196 School Board Meets March 1 To Discuss Changing COVID Plan

DAKOTA COUNTY, MN — ISD 196 announced that its school board will meet on March 1 to discuss making changes to its COVID-19 plan.

The meeting will take place at 5:30 p.m. at Dakota Ridge School, the district said.

Because of this meeting, the Community Listening Session on Feb. 28 will be cancelled, but the public comment section of the special meeting on March 1 will be expanded, the district said. Signup for public comment will be available at the meeting, according to the district's website.

The meeting will also be live-streamed on the district's YouTube channel, according to the district.
